WebThat irony and dialectic are the two great forces in Plato everyone will surely admit, but that there is a double kind of dialectic cannot be denied, either. There is an irony that is only a stimulus for thought, that quickens it when it becomes drowsy, disciplines when it becomes dissolute. Webirony such as (1)–(3) are best analysed as cases of echoic allusion, and not of pretence. 2. Three puzzling features of irony From the classical point of view, irony presents three puzzling features that have often been noted and that an adequate theory should explain: Attitude in irony and metaphor WebYet, irony is a complex rhetorical move. It depends on deep and shared levels of understanding, knowing namely, that one means what one doesn't mean and that that actually means something else completely. It produces a "scene." In Irony's edge, Linda Hutcheon examines the nature of this "scene." She explores what constitutes irony, how …
